We have passion and enthusiasm and are looking for like-minded people to join us on our journey.**: **We are looking for**: Byron Shire Council is currently seeking to fill 2x new Finance roles: Finance Officer (Accounts Support & Rates) and Revenue Officer (Debt Management).
The **Finance Officer (Accounts Support & Rates)** role is a great opportunity to complete an extensive range of accounting support tasks within Council’s Finance team including assistance with Council’s rates and charges revenue administrative functions and provide high level customer service to internal and external customers.
The **Revenue Officer (Debt Management) **role is a great opportunity to provide a high level of customer service while undertaking Council’s revenue debt recovery function of amounts owing to Council for rates and charges, in accordance with the Local Government Act 1993 and Council Policies and procedures
